Bytes.co is a Burlington, Vermont-based web design, digital marketing, and development agency founded in 2010. They serve 400+ clients across the United States with a focus on transparency, commitment, and crafting digital experiences that matter.

Linden Digital Marketing is a Rochester-based agency that provides customized digital marketing services through straightforward service packages. They help businesses define their place in the digital world with a focus on growth at any stage.
